Spending By Bank Cards Up 27%
- 17 Mar 2016 11:00 AM
- shopping
Transactions by bank cards rose 12% to 112 million in the fourth quarter of 2015, reaching Ft 841 billion in value, a 27% annual increase, according to figures from the MNB. Contactless cards accounted for 38% of all transactions, a rise of 240% from the previous year, and for 24% of all spending, an increase of 280%.

Déli Railway Station To Be Made Into A Park
- 11 Mar 2016 8:00 AM
- getting around
The cabinet plans to demolish Déli train station and replace it with a green space, Prime Minister’s Office leader János Lázár told his weekly press conference yesterday. The development minister is to carry out a feasibility study on the future of Déli station and the expansion of Kelenföldi train station, under a resolution published yesterday in Magyar Közlöny.

Costes Downtown Budapest Restaurant Receives Michelin Star
- 10 Mar 2016 8:00 AM
- food & drink
Costes DownTown has become the fifth Budapest restaurant to win a Michelin star in the gourmand guide’s latest edition. The eatery opened last June in the Prestige Hotel Budapest on Vigyázó Ferenc utca in the Fifth District. The winning chefs are Petra Tischler and Tiago Sabarigo.
